What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Insulin Pump Educator position, and why are they important?
To thrive as an Insulin Pump Educator, you need a solid understanding of diabetes management, insulin pump technology, and patient education principles, often supported by certifications such as CDE (Certified Diabetes Educator) or RN licensure. Familiarity with insulin pump brands, contin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) systems, and electronic health records is typ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, patience, and cultural sensitivity help build trust and empower patients to manage their diabetes effectively. These skills are crucial to ensure safe, individualized patient care and successful adoption of complex medical devices.
What does a typical day look like for an Insulin Pump Educator?
A typical day for an Insulin Pump Educator involves conducting individual or group training sessions with patients, troubleshooting device issues, and coordinating closely with endocrinologists and other healthcare providers. Educators may assess new patients' readiness for pump therapy, tailor programs to diverse learning styles, and provide ongoing support via phone or video calls. The role often requires a mix of patient-facing time and administrative duties such as maintaining records and updating care plans. You can expect to work in clinics, hospitals, or diabetes care centers, frequently as part of a multidisciplinary team dedicated to improving diabetes outcomes.
What does an Insulin Pump Educator do?
An Insulin Pump Educator trains patients on how to use insulin pumps to manage diabetes effectively. They provide education on pump settings, troubleshooting, and best practices for insulin delivery. They work closely with healthcare providers to tailor pump therapy to each patient's needs. Their role also includes offering ongoing support to help patients optimize blood sugar control and improve their quality of life.

Join UChicago Medicine, as a Clinical Nurse Educator - Diabetes (CNE-D) in the Department of Diabetes Patient Education.
We are seeking a collaborative and dynamic Clinical Nurse Educator - Diabetes with current CDCES credentialing to support our inpatient diabetes education program across adult and pediatric populations. Reporting through the Clinical Nutrition and Diabetes Patient Education leadership team, this role serves as an educator, consultant, mentor, advocate, and clinical resource focused on advancing diabetes care, improving patient outcomes, and supporting professional nursing development.
In partnership with nursing leadership and interdisciplinary teams, the Clinical Nurse Educator - Diabetes provides specialized education in diabetes management, including insulin administration, glucose monitoring technologies, and insulin pump therapy. The role also supports the ongoing development of nursing and clinical staff through evidence-based education, coaching, and mentorship to promote safe, high-quality patient care.
Essential Job Functions
Patient & Family Education
- Assesses the educational needs of pediatric and adult patients with diabetes, as well as their families and support systems.
- Provides individualized and evidence-based diabetes self-management education, including:
- Insulin administration training
- Blood glucose meter and continuous glucose monitor (CGM) education
- Insulin pump therapy education
- Survival skill education
- Utilizes standardized and customized teaching tools to evaluate patient and caregiver understanding and competency.
- Collaborates with interdisciplinary teams to support timely discharge planning and continuity of care across inpatient and outpatient settings.
- Communicates effectively with patients, families, nursing staff, providers, and consult services to coordinate education and care needs.
Staff Education & Professional Development
- Assesses learning needs of nursing and clinical staff within the specialty area.
- Develops and implements educational programs and competency-based learning activities related to diabetes care and clinical practice.
- Designs and facilitates educational initiatives aligned with organizational priorities, evidence-based practice, regulatory standards, and quality improvement goals.
Education Program Development & Evaluation
- Designs and delivers educational activities using adult learning principles and diverse teaching methodologies.
- Promotes a culture of continuous learning, professional growth, and clinical excellence.
- Evaluates effectiveness of educational programs through learner feedback, competency assessment, practice change, and outcome measures.
- Supports quality improvement, patient safety, and practice standardization initiatives related to diabetes management.
